A jungle breakfest is a great way to add excitement to your trip. Bring several, small boxes of easy-to-fix foods, such as cereals, fruits, snacks, and other quick, yet healthy, meals. When your kids get up, have them hunt down their breakfast. This activity adds a bit more fun to camping.

Make sure that you choose the right sleeping bag for the conditions on the campsite. So bring a lighter sleeping bag for the hotter months out of the year, and a thicker one for the colder months out of the year. Make sure your sleeping bag fits you well, hugs your body and helps you to retain heat.

While creating a survival kit, include waterproof matches. Store them in airtight containers. You can make regular matches waterproof by dipping them into either paraffin or nail polish. A film container or pill bottle can serve for storage.
